(Clearwisdom.net) On April 15, 2006, to cooperate with the "Asian-Pacific Area Synchronized 24 hours Hunger Strike" calling for a complete investigation on the Chinese Communist regime's (CCP) stealing and selling organs of practitioners, a group of practitioners from coastal area, Chia-i City, Taiwan held a hunger strike at Puzi Art Park in the rain. The practitioners want to call on people to learn the facts of the organ smuggling that the CCP committed, and condemn and stop the atrocities.

Despite a rainy day of April 15, starting at 9:00 a.m. a group of practitioners from the costal area came to do meditation in Puzi Art Park. According to a practitioner named Hou, ever since the Sujiatun incident of harvesting organs from living practitioners in a concentration camp was exposed by a witness, the inhumanity has been highlighted and condemned by the international community. To destroy the evidence, the CCP urgently relocated all the practitioners to other forced labor camps, prisons and other locations, and started to do away with witnesses to eliminate evidence. Therefore we call on all the people of conscience to step forward to condemn the CCP's inhumanity. He said, "Many people still don't know the brutality of the persecution against practitioners. The CCP has been blocking all information and alluring western media with an inflated market in mainland China. They put pressure on the international media, so that the barbaric persecution of the practitioners has yet to be fully exposed. We are here to do meditation, help people learn the facts, work together to stop the persecution, and rescue those practitioners who are still suffering from the persecution."

A passerby learned about the CCP's atrocities of live organ harvesting for profit and then cremating remains to eliminate the evidence. Looking at the practitioners sitting in the rain, he shook his head and then said, "No wonder even heaven is also shedding tears."

Some other practitioners from Chia-i City went to Chung-cheng Park to expose the CCP's atrocities to the public, and collect signatures to condemn the CCP. They also called for an end to the persecution and the protection of human rights.
